Skip to content

[pull] master from square:master#24

Merged
pull[bot] merged 8 commits intoxtiii:masterfrom
square:master
May 28, 2025
Merged

[pull] master from square:master#24
pull[bot] merged 8 commits intoxtiii:masterfrom
square:master

Conversation

@pull
Copy link
Copy Markdown

@pull pull bot commented May 28, 2025

See Commits and Changes for more details.


Created by pull[bot] (v2.0.0-alpha.1)

Can you help keep this open source service alive? 💖 Please sponsor : )

swankjesse and others added 8 commits May 27, 2025 14:34
* Get the OSGi plugin to work with Kotlin/Multiplatform

This introduces a hacky workaround to a BND bug:
bndtools/bnd#6590

* Fix build issues

---------

Co-authored-by: Jesse Wilson <jwilson@squareup.com>
* Inline RequestCommon

This is an artifact of our multiplatform exploration.

* Fixup null tags

* Spotless

---------

Co-authored-by: Jesse Wilson <jwilson@squareup.com>
* Fix a failing test by adding a FollowUpDecision event

* Fix up the other events list

---------

Co-authored-by: Jesse Wilson <jwilson@squareup.com>
* Fix native image tests' build

They need friendsImplementation to test internal APIs

* Also fix the package name

---------

Co-authored-by: Jesse Wilson <jwilson@squareup.com>
* Stop double-compressing the PublicSuffixDatabase

It's compressed as a .gz file that's also in a .jar file.

Previously the compressed size was 42,502 bytes, and the
total okhttp.jar file was 884,193.

With this change, the total okhttp.jar file is 884,154 bytes.

* PR feedback

* Spotless
Co-authored-by: Jesse Wilson <jwilson@squareup.com>
* Upgrade Okio to 3.12.0

* Start using BufferedSource.indexOf() with a toIndex

This avoids the need for the new FixedLengthSource class.

---------

Co-authored-by: Jesse Wilson <jwilson@squareup.com>
…0.4 (#8814)

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
@pull pull bot added the ⤵️ pull label May 28, 2025
@pull pull bot merged commit 1ae04ad into xtiii:master May 28,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ant